FusionProtFeatures for CAMK1D_FAM188A


check buttonMain function of each fusion partner protein. (from UniProt)
HgeneTgene
CAMK1D

Q8IU85

FAM188A

Calcium/calmodulin-dependent protein kinase thatoperates in the calcium-triggered CaMKK-CaMK1 signaling cascadeand, upon calcium influx, activates CREB-dependent genetranscription, regulates calcium-mediated granulocyte function andrespiratory burst and promotes basal dendritic growth ofhippocampal neurons. In neutrophil cells, required for cytokine-induced proliferative responses and activation of the respiratoryburst. Activates the transcription factor CREB1 in hippocampalneuron nuclei. May play a role in apoptosis of erythroleukemiacells. In vitro, phosphorylates transcription factor CREM isoformBeta. {ECO:0000269|PubMed:11050006, ECO:0000269|PubMed:15840691,ECO:0000269|PubMed:16324104, ECO:0000269|PubMed:17056143}. Lectin that binds to various sugars: galactose > mannose= fucose > N-acetylglucosamine > N-acetylgalactosamine(PubMed:10224141). Acts as a chemoattractant, probably involved inthe regulation of cell migration (PubMed:28301481).{ECO:0000269|PubMed:10224141, ECO:0000269|PubMed:28301481}.
